// Section A.24: Jump and Link
// Mimicking the Sparc's instr def...
def JMPLCALLr : F3_1<2, 0b111000, "jmpl">; // jmpl [r+r], r
-def JMPLCALLi : F3_1<2, 0b111000, "jmpl">; // jmpl [r+i], r
-def JMPLRETr : F3_1<2, 0b111000, "jmpl">; // jmpl [r+r], r
-def JMPLRETi : F3_1<2, 0b111000, "jmpl">; // jmpl [r+i], r
+def JMPLCALLi : F3_2<2, 0b111000, "jmpl">; // jmpl [r+i], r
+def JMPLRETr : F3_1<2, 0b111000, "jmpl">; // jmpl [r+r], r
+def JMPLRETi : F3_2<2, 0b111000, "jmpl">; // jmpl [r+i], r
// FIXME: FCMPS, FCMPD, FCMPQ !!!
// FIXME: FMULS, FMULD, FMULQ, ...